Harneys Pledge Financial Support For Ag Show

February 9, 2016

Harneys Bermuda has pledged its financial support to the upcoming Agricultural Show, which is set to take place at the Botanical Gardens from April 14 – 16, 2016.

“The AG Show Ltd - registered charity number 968 was established in Bermuda last year as a not for profit company limited by guarantee,” the event organisers said.

“This year’s show is being produced through a public–private initiative formalised through memorandum of Understanding between the AG Show Ltd and the Government of Bermuda.

“The much needed financial support will assist with offsetting the cost of hosting this year’s show. Established last February the AG Show Ltd and its committee members along with the Government of Bermuda have been hard at work with the logistical planning and promotion of the show.”

Sarah-Jane Hurrion, Managing Partner of Harneys Bermuda, commented: “Harneys is delighted to sponsor the Bermuda Agricultural Exhibition. It is a culturally significant celebration that enriches the lives of exhibitors and attendees alike.

“As part of our work within the community, Harneys supports and promotes the arts and culture, and we are pleased to partner with like-minded organisations and events.

“Our commitment to Bermuda extends beyond building a leading full-service legal and fiduciary practice to making a positive impact in our community, and we look forward to attending this year’s event,” added Ms Hurrion.
